CONN THE SPOT

WIMBLEDON boss Johnnie Jackson was down in the dumps after his promotion contenders chucked away a potentially crucial two points.
The Dons were cruising thanks to strikes from Marcus Browne and Matty Stevens.
But Barrow subs Dean Campbell and Connor Mahoney netted late on, with the equaliser coming in the sixth minute of added time.
Wimbledon remain in League Two's third automatic promotion slot - but only by a thread.
And Jackson said: "That feels like a sucker punch after a really strong second-half performance.
